This is a different kind of Ukoy, we used Ubod instead of togue or kalabasa.
Estimated cooking time: 40 minutes
Ukoy na Ubod Ingredients: |
Ukoy na Ubod Cooking Instructions: |
Boil the shrimp until cooked then peel the shell
Dissolve the cornstarch in water.
Mix with atsuete oil then add the shrimps, onions, salt, pepper, eggs and ubod.
Blend well.
Heat vegetable oil for frying.
When hot, drop the mixture by tablespoons. Place two to three shrimps on top and fry until crisp and golden brown.
